val douest Posted March 9, 2009 Share Posted March 9, 2009 For those of you who don't already know it, there is a fascinating website called the Cottage Smallholder (http://www.cottagesmallholder.com/). Its subheading is Stumbling self sufficiency in a small space and apart from being a fascinating read it is full of inexpensive but interesting recipes, advice on growing and using garden produce, keeping poultry etc, all so well written (the author is a a journalist turned smallholder) that they are worth reading for their own sake. Although it is UK based, lots of the information is just as useful here in France. Good photos too!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
